Description:
At work we have a use case to read Avro records from Kafka, and to write them
to one of several BigQuery tables (based on compatibility). This means that
there is no single schema (with all data) that is compatible with all records
we'll be reading.
In order to allow this, we'd like to be able to use the BinaryMessageDecoder
without any read schema, and have it use the write schema of each record as the
read schema for that record.
